python,import mysql.connector,,cnx = mysql.connector.connect(user='username', password='password',, host='127.0.0.1',, database='database_name'),cnx.close(),
“,,请将’username’,’password’和’database_name’替换为实际的用户名、密码和数据库名称。在数字化时代,数据库扮演着至关重要的角色,MySQL作为一个广泛应用在全球的开源关系型数据库管理系统,更是众多开发者和数据库管理员的首选,了解如何通过命令行访问 MySQL 数据库表,对于管理数据和执行数据库操作来说极为重要,小编将深入探讨这一过程及其相关的操作:

1、启动并登录 MySQL 数据库
启动 MySQL 服务:确保 MySQL 服务已经安装并正确配置,可以通过net start mysql
命令来启动服务。
登录到 MySQL 命令行客户端:打开命令提示符(Windows 用户)或终端(Linux/macOS 用户),然后使用mysql u <数据库用户名> p
命令登录到 MySQL 客户端,通常情况下,使用 root 用户登录,因为这是一个具有所有权限的超级用户。
2、基本数据库操作
查看数据库列表:登录后,使用show databases;
命令可以查看当前 MySQL 服务器上的所 有数据库列表。

选择数据库:通过use <数据库名>;
命令选择你需要操作的数据库,只有选择了某个数据库之后,才能对其内部的表进行操作。
3、查看与描述数据库表
查看数据库中的表:使用show tables;
命令可以列出当前选中的数据库中的所有表。
查看表的结构:describe <表名>;
或简写为desc <表名>;
,这个命令会展示表中各个字段的详细信息,包括字段名、类型、是否允许为 NULL 以及键信息等。
4、创建数据库及表

创建数据库:通过create database <数据库名>;
命令可以创建一个新的数据库。
创建表:首先需要设计好表的结构,包括列名、数据类型以及主键等信息,然后使用CREATE TABLE <表名> (列定义);
的语法来创建新表。
在探讨以上内容后,以下还有几点需要注意:
数据安全与备份:定期对数据库进行备份是防止数据丢失的重要措施,可以使用mysqldump
工具来进行数据库备份。
性能优化:随着数据量的增加,数据库的性能可能会受到影响,合理地使用索引、优化查询语句和适时进行数据清理,都是提升数据库性能的有效手段。
通过命令行访问和管理 MySQL 数据库表是一项基础而重要的技能,对于数据库管理员和开发人员而言尤为关键,本文详细介绍了从启动 MySQL 服务到登录数据库,再到查看、创建和描述数据库表的过程,还探讨了数据备份与恢复的重要性,以及数据库性能优化的基本方法,掌握这些操作,不仅可以帮助更好地管理数据,还能在必要时进行有效的数据保护和恢复。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复